How Much Does an Indian Wedding Photographer Cost in Sydney?
An Indian wedding is rarely a single day. Between the mehndi, the sangeet, the ceremony and the reception, there is a lot to capture - which means photography pricing works a little differently than for a one-day wedding. Here is a clear, honest guide to what it costs, and how to get genuine value.
What Drives the Cost
The main factors are simple: how many events you want covered, how many hours each runs, whether you want photography, film, or both, and whether you want a second photographer for the larger events. An Indian wedding often benefits from a two-person team, especially for a baraat or a big reception, where a great deal happens at once.

Getting Real Value Across Events
The smartest way to budget for an Indian wedding is to decide which events you would be most disappointed to lose, and cover those properly rather than spreading thin coverage across everything. A dedicated few hours on the mehndi and sangeet and full coverage of the ceremony and reception often gives the best gallery for the money.
Why Understanding the Culture Matters
Cost is only half the story - value comes from a photographer who understands the day. Knowing the order of an Indian wedding means being ready for each key moment rather than chasing it, so you are not paying for hours where the important frames were missed.
